Danemarca anunță noi metode de prevenire a utilizării inteligenței artificale în rândul elevilor: Susținerea orală a referatelor, monitorizarea ecranelor și realizarea temelor la școală
Denmark's government has introduced a strategy to curb AI use in secondary education, requiring oral defenses of essays and increased monitoring during exams. The measures target students aged 16 to 19 and aim to ensure independent thinking and knowledge retention. Schools will implement digital surveillance tools and increase supervised writing assignments to better assess student capabilities. This initiative responds to a significant rise in AI misuse among students, with reported sanctions increasing dramatically in Sweden.
